Whiting, John Randolph was born on April 22, 1914 in New York City. Son of John Clapp and Elizabeth Margaret (Zittel) Whiting.

Bachelor of Arts in Journalism, Ohio University, 1936.
Reporter newspapers, Ohio and New York State., 1935-1936; associate editor, Literature Digest, 1936-1937; associate editor, True magazine, 1937-1938; free-lance writer for magazines, 1938-1940; managing editor, Click magazine, 1940-1941; managing editor, Popular Photography magazine, 1942-1946; editor, Science Illustrated magazine, 1947-1949; public, editor, Flower Grower magazine, 1949-1960; executive vice president, Popular Science Public Company, 1961-1966; president, Communigraphics Cons., 1966-1967; public, Motor Boating and Sailing Magazine, Hearst Magazine division, 1967-1975; editor public motor boating and sailing books, Motor Boating and Sailing Magazine, Hearst Magazine division, 1975-1979; public, editor, Hearst Marine Books, 1979-1981; consultant editor, Hearst Marine Books, since 1981. Director Hastings Federal Savings & Loan Association. Lecturer Colonial Williamsburg, universities, corporations and associations on photo-journalism, illustrative photography.

Trustee Community Hospital Dobbs Ferry, New York. Member American Association for the Advancement of Science, Boating Writers International (president 1973-1979), National Association Science Writers, Garden Writers Association (past president), Photograph Society of America, Phi Delta Theta, Sigma Delta Chi, Kappa Alpha Museum Clubs: New York Yacht (New York City), Overseas Press (New York City). Cliffdwellers (Chicago).
Married Helen Louise Gamertsfelder, June 3, 1937. Children: Wendy Helen Whiting Livingston, Merry Natalie Whiting Coleman, Robin Elizabeth Whiting Uhr.
